Under the supervision of the Team Supervisor and Department Manager, the Donation Processing Representative will work in key aspects of the departmental processes associated with processing and recording ministry donations.

Responsibilities
Key Result #1 – Serve as a member of the team that processes donations and sponsorship registration cards (approximately 90%).
Key Result #2 – Support other departmental activities to enhance the sponsor and donor experience (approximately 10%).
